| People | Faroe Islands |
= Fields = World Records = Dictionary = Bar graph = Distribution map = Fields History = Definitions |
Population:
 | 48,668 (July 2008 est.) |
Population density:
 | 35 people per sq km land area |
Age structure:
 | 0-14 years: 21.9% (male 5,489/female 5,166) 15-64 years: 64% (male 16,650/female 14,482) 65 years and over: 14.1% (male 3,233/female 3,648) (2008 est.) |
Median age:
 | total: 36.7 years male: 36 years female: 37.5 years (2008 est.) |
Population growth rate:
 | 0.376% (2008 est.) |
Birth rate:
 | 13.25 births/1,000 population (2008 est.) |
Death rate:
 | 8.67 deaths/1,000 population (2008 est.) |
Net migration rate:
 | -0.82 migrant(s)/1,000 population (2008 est.) |
Sex ratio:
 | at birth: 1.07 male(s)/female under 15 years: 1.06 male(s)/female 15-64 years: 1.15 male(s)/female 65 years and over: 0.89 male(s)/female total population: 1.09 male(s)/female (2008 est.) |
Infant mortality rate:
 | total: 6.46 deaths/1,000 live births male: 6.69 deaths/1,000 live births female: 6.2 deaths/1,000 live births (2008 est.) |
Life expectancy at birth:
 | total population: 79.29 years male: 76.86 years female: 81.89 years (2008 est.) |
Total fertility rate:
 | 2.45 children born/woman (2008 est.) |

Nationality:
 | noun: Faroese (singular and plural) adjective: Faroese |
Ethnic groups:
 | Scandinavian |
Religions:
 | Evangelical Lutheran 83.8%, other and unspecified 16.2% (2006 administrative data) |
Languages:
 | Faroese (derived from Old Norse), Danish |
Literacy:
 | NA; note - probably 99%, the same as Denmark proper |
